A Region Full of Character
The Hauts-de-France region boasts dozens of belfries and Gothic cathedrals, and offers a wide variety of landscapes, from the forested countryside to the bustling cities. The capital is Lille, a buzzing town full of great art and culture. Lens is in the spotlight for its Louvre‑Lens Museum, and Amiens is renowned for its green floating gardens, the ‘hortillonnages’.
